Comprehensive Definitions & Senses

1 sense
As noun
  1. 1

    The quality or state of being conscious or aware of something, or a mental state achieved by focusing one's awareness on the present moment.

    "Practicing mindfulness can help reduce stress and anxiety in daily life."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ology

The term 'mindfulness' originates from the Old English word 'mynd', meaning 'memory' or 'thought'. It evolved through Middle English and was influenced by the Pali word 'sati', which refers to awareness or attention, particularly in Buddhist contexts, gaining prominence in Western psychology in the late 20th century.
